FS#72280 - quassel-client-qt crashes after qt5-wayland upgrade

Attached to Project: Arch Linux
Opened by Robert Clipsham (mrmonday) - Wednesday, 29 September 2021, 07:04 GMT
Last edited by Antonio Rojas (arojas) - Wednesday, 29 September 2021, 10:48 GMT
Task Type Bug Report
Category Packages: Extra
Status Closed
Assigned To No-one
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

Description:

After the following updates:

[2021-09-28T23:45:06+0100] [ALPM] upgraded qt5-declarative (5.15.2+kde+r30-1 -> 5.15.2+kde+r31-1)
[2021-09-28T23:45:06+0100] [ALPM] upgraded qt5-wayland (5.15.2+kde+r30-1 -> 5.15.2+kde+r33-1)

quassel-client-qt (0.13.1-8) segfaults at start up when running on Wayland.

Downgrading to the previous versions resolves this.

Steps to reproduce:

1. Install quassel-client-qt (0.13.1-8), qt5-declarative (5.15.2+kde+r31-1), and qt5-wayland (5.15.2+kde+r33-1)
2. In a wayland session, run `QT_QPA_PLATFORM=wayland quasselclient`
3. The package should crash at startup
This task depends upon

Closed by  Antonio Rojas (arojas)
Wednesday, 29 September 2021, 10:48 GMT
Reason for closing:  Works for me
Additional comments about closing:  Reason for request: After upgrading the packages again to get a backtrace, it no longer crashes. I assume whatever happened was either transient or caused by something other than the listed packages.
Comment by Antonio Rojas (arojas) - Wednesday, 29 September 2021, 09:15 GMT
Can't reproduce, please post a backtrace. Is this a Plasma session?
Comment by Robert Clipsham (mrmonday) - Wednesday, 29 September 2021, 09:30 GMT
This is in a gnome session. I'll get a backtrace for you later today - I forgot to save it earlier. It happened somewhere in the Qt/wayland platform initialization code.

Loading...